• DocumentCode
    3685873
  • Title

    A simple Erlang API for handling DDS data types and Quality of Service parameters

  • Author

    Wafa Helali;Khaled Barbaria;Belhassen Zouari

  • Author_Institution
    LIP2 Lab, University of Tunis, El Manar, Tunisia
  • fYear
    2015
  • fDate
    4/1/2015 12:00:00 AM
  • Firstpage
    19
  • Lastpage
    26
  • Abstract
    The choice of the programming language impacts the efficiency of the application and the robustness of the code. The characteristics of Erlang as a functional programming language supported distributed real time computing allowed us to propose eDDS: an Erlang based middleware compliant to the Data Distribution Service (DDS) standard that providing a strong Quality of Service (QoS) support. When the performance and the compliance to the norm have been easy achieved in particular on defining and setting QoS parameters, the lack of efficient and user-friendly support for data type management has been noticed. In this paper, we will explain this type checking problem and how we solved it.
  • Keywords
    "Quality of service","Middleware","Computer languages","Functional programming","Real-time systems","Distributed databases"
  • Publisher
    ieee
  • Conference_Titel
    Evaluation of Novel Approaches to Software Engineering (ENASE), 2015 International Conference on
  • Type

    conf

  • Filename
    7320329